Specific system log message Information:
Name
L2ALD_MAC_MOVE_NOTIF_ACTION
Message
MAC move <variable>error-message</variable>
Help
MAC Move action related detailed information
Description
When the same MAC address is learned on a different interface, or on the same interface but a different unit number, it is considered a MAC move. When this happens frequently for a specific time duration, and bridge domain has action enabled, the IFL on which the mac is learnt last is blocked for the bridge domain. A notification is sent with blocking/unblocking event, Offending MAC(for blocking), IFL name and bridge domain.
Type
Event: This message reports an event, not an error
Severity
notice
Cause
The probable reason for mac moves is the loops in the topology or some kind of misconfiguration. The blocking action is taken to stop the loop for a configurable duration.
Facility
LOG_DAEMON
